AI Agents Do Not Need Their Own Identity System. WinMagic Says One Architecture Can Cover AllWith machine identities already outnumbering humans 82 to 1, WinMagic argues AI agents should be verified through a common trust architecture spanning users, devices, workloads, and machines. TORONTO, July 28, 2026 /PRNewswire/ -- Cybersecurity teams are preparing for AI agents by adding new credentials, policies, and controls to identity environments already divided across users, devices, service accounts, and cloud workloads. A 2025 survey found 82 machine identities for every human identity and that 70% of respondents considered identity silos a root cause of cybersecurity risk. Thi Nguyen-Huu, President and CEO of WinMagic, a cybersecurity innovator known for endpoint-based authentication and encryption, says the work on AI agents' identity is necessary but it should not become another identity silo. The architecture that covers AI agents can cover users, devices, service accounts, and workloads.
What each of them needs is a trusted witness at the point of access that can confirm who is acting, on what platform, and under what conditions. "Identity is what you verify before you give access," said Nguyen-Huu. "Online, it cannot be the user alone. It has to be the actor, on a platform, under a defined set of conditions. Once you define identity that way, there is no reason to build a new architecture for a new actor." Authorization s Not the Same as Identity One Architecture Does Not Mean One-Size-Fits-All In connected environments, the endpoint evaluates local conditions while external systems provide additional authorization and risk signals. In disconnected or air-gapped environments, the endpoint assumes more of that responsibility because outside services may be unavailable. If required conditions change, the Live Key, protected in device hardware, is no longer available for the next connection. "A unified architecture does not mean every environment works the same way," Nguyen-Huu points out. "The conditions change; the principle does not. Access continues only while the conditions that justified it still hold. Until now, the only way to approximate that was a timer, which is a guess about the future." Every Authorized User Already Has a Trusted Witness MagicEndpoint applies that model alongside existing identity and access management systems. Mutual Transport Layer Security allows machines to prove possession of cryptographic keys during a connection, making AI agents a natural fit. WinMagic extends the same machine-to-machine architecture to people by allowing the endpoint to hold the key and vouch for the verified user. The missing ingredient is not cryptography or hardware. It is a practical way to continuously verify people without repeatedly interrupting them. By shifting that responsibility to the endpoint, a mechanism originally designed for machines can also support human identity.
